Since Mufasa: The Lion King trailer was released, the internet had mixed responses, some even felt disappointed and questioned Barry Jenkins's involvement with Disney.
During an interview with 'Variety,' director Barry Jenkins disclosed that the prequel intends to delve into the dynamics between Mufasa and his younger brother Taka, who later becomes known as Scar. Aaron Pierre and Kelvin Harrison Jr. have been confirmed to voice the younger versions of Mufasa and Scar respectively.
Fans in India were abuzz with speculation regarding the potential return of Bollywood icon Shah Rukh Khan to lend his voice to the beloved character of Mufasa, much like he did for the 2019 live-action Hindi dubbed version of 'The Lion King'. Desi twitterati also rooted for the makers to cast AbRam Khan as young Mufasa.
"Mufasa: The Lion King" trailer offers a glimpse into Mufasa's past, featuring a star-studded cast including Blue Ivy Carter. The prequel, directed by Barry Jenkins, is set to hit theaters on December 20.
